Gindi Equities Completes Sale of 109-Unit Greenview Meadows Multifamily Community in Charlotte Metro Submarket of Gastonia

CHARLOTTE, NC - Gindi Equities today announced the sale of Greenview Meadows, a 109-unit multifamily property located at 1613 Greenview Drive in Gastonia, North Carolina, for $14.5 million, or approximately $133,000 per apartment.

Acquired by Gindi Equities for $10 million in February 2021, Greenview Meadows features a mix of two- and three-bedroom apartments.  It is situated in a prime location within a 20-minute drive of Charlotte International Airport and Uptown Charlotte, an economic hotspot for banking, insurance, energy, transportation and healthcare.  Gindi Equities enhanced the residential community through a series of capital improvements since its acquisition, which included modernizing apartment interiors and upgrading on-site amenities with a new pet park, playground, picnic areas and renovated pool deck.

This transaction quickly follows another successful multifamily sale for Gindi Equities.  After acquiring the nearby Cedar Ridge Apartments in April 2021 for $10 million, Gindi Equities sold the 104-unit multifamily community for $13.5 million in August.
